Artistic Team

Elizabeth Crase holds an Associate of Fine Arts in Theatre from Young Harris College in Georgia, as well as a Bachelor of Fine Arts in Acting from the University of Montana. Her MFA in Integrated Arts in Education is in progress with the Creative Pulse at the University of Montana. She began theatre at a young age in Georgia performing with Rome Little Theatre and had the unique experience of working as an intern with Prospect Theatre Company out of NYC while still in high school.

After performing in theaters across the south in over 40 productions and projects, Elizabeth worked in Butte as both an actor and as Education Coordinator with the Buttenik Ensemble at the Covellite Theatre from 2005-2008. She also had the amazing experience of touring with Montana Repertory’s Educational Outreach Tour as Eve in Mark Twain’s The Diaries of Adam and Eve in 2008. Following her tour, Elizabeth worked as Assistant Director for an after school theatre program called Promises in Portland, OR. During her time in Portland she also worked as a performer and as the Live Acts Coordinator for Clowns Unlimited where she trained performers in clowning, balloon art, face painting, stilt walking, stage hypnotism and stage magic. In 2011, Elizabeth returned to Montana as an actor with Brewery Follies of Virginia City where she performed for three years and again in 2019.

Elizabeth Crase
Executive Artistic Director

Since becoming a part of the artistic team at Orphan Girl Children's Theatre, Elizabeth has directed close to 40 shows, productions and projects. She feels passionately about educating through the arts and looks at every day as a new opportunity to learn something from, teach something to, and share something creative with the artists, volunteers and community surrounding OGCT.

  • Fred Crase

    MUSIC DIRECTOR

    Since 2015, Fred has worked with Orphan Girl Children’s/Community Theatre as a Music Director and Vocal Coach, as well as appearing onstage in several productions as an actor.

    Fred is a Butte native and graduate of Butte Central High School. He received his Bachelor of Music in Composition and Technology from the University of Montana and his Master of Music in Composition from the University of Glasgow in Glasgow, UK (Scotland). Fred became one of the founding members of the Buttenik Ensemble at the Covellite Theatre in Butte, MT in 2004, where he worked as the Music Director until 2007. In 2009, Fred took part in the World Premiere of 6:01 am, a hip hop/spoken word musical, as the Composer and Conductor with members of the Reno Philharmonic and Nevada Opera Orchestras in Reno, Nevada.

    He is also the Musical Director for the Brewery Follies in Virginia City, MT and has held this position since he returned to Montana in 2010. He is also the director of the Copper Hill Choir of Montana Tech, the Mining City Choral Union, and the Aldersgate Chancel Choir.
